Rex Dieter wrote: > Garry Reisky wrote: >> I loaded up krdc and I didn't see the option for vnc connections. I had >> previously downloaded the kubuntu 4.0 live cd so I booted it up and I >> loaded their krdc and it had the vnc option. I'm just wondering if the >> fedora version is supposed to have this or was it disabled because it >> was buggy. Just wondering. > Looks like a missing dependency: > + libvncserver, 0.9: VNC Server library > <http://libvncserver.sourceforge.net/> > Needed to build Krfb and VNC support in Krdc > which isn't in fedora (yet).
